Overview

Espresso Systems is a private Web3 enterprise focused on enhancing blockchain transaction ordering, privacy, and scalability. Founded in 2020 by Ben Fisch, Charles Lu, and Benedikt Bünz, the company is headquartered in Menlo Park, CA, USA. It aims to provide Layer 1 solutions that integrate Proof-of-Stake consensus protocols with Zero-Knowledge Rollup technology. Over the years, Espresso Systems has raised significant funding, amounting to $60 million through various rounds.

Recent Developments

Espresso Systems has been at the forefront of Web3 innovation, making strides in decentralized transaction processing and interoperability. Below are key developments from 2023 to 2024:

  • September 2024: Alongside Offchain Labs, Espresso Systems released the Decentralized Timeboost specification, a major milestone aimed at enhancing decentralized transaction ordering on Arbitrum DAO. This specification addresses key challenges like front-running and Maximal Extractable Value (MEV) concerns.
  • March 2024: The company successfully secured $28 million in a Series B funding round led by Andreessen Horowitz, involving participation from Polygon Labs and other key industry stakeholders. This funding is earmarked for further product development and scaling.
  • March 2023: Earlier innovations introduced by Offchain Labs on transaction ordering, termed Timeboost, were refined in partnership with Espresso Systems, focusing on compatibility with decentralized sequencers.
  • Over the past year, Espresso has focused on integrating the Timeboost protocol to ensure efficient and fair transaction ordering, which is particularly relevant to the Ethereum ecosystem.

Early History

Espresso Systems was founded as a response to high costs and limited privacy in existing blockchain solutions. The team, with roots in Stanford University, leveraged their expertise to create infrastructure that focuses on privacy and scalability using advanced cryptographic techniques like zero-knowledge proofs. In its early phases, Espresso aimed to deliver Layer 1 blockchain innovations, focusing on reducing transaction fees and improving privacy settings.

Company Profile and Achievements

Espresso Systems operates as a B2B entity offering advanced blockchain solutions. It's widely recognized for its flagship product, the Espresso Sequencer, which decentralizes transaction sequencing in blockchain networks. Key achievements include:

  • Creation of the CAPE Smart Contract: Allowing asset creators to offer configurable privacy settings on Ethereum.
  • Efficient Transaction Processing: The use of a shared sequencing marketplace that boosts interoperability across various blockchains.
  • Innovative Use of Proof-of-Stake and ZK-Rollup Technology: Enabling remarkable enhancements in transaction throughput while maintaining security.
  • Significant Funding Success: Having raised $32 million in 2022 and followed by a successful $28 million round in 2024.
